Synthesis,Characterization And Properties Of Half-Sandwich Iridium And Ruthenium Complexes With Acylhydrazone

One of the most important methods for synthesizing C-N bonds in organic synthesis is the N-alkylation of amines.The method mainly applies the hydrogen borrowing strategy.It mainly uses transition metal catalysts to activate alcohols as reagents for alkylation reaction.Half-sandwich metal complexes boast high thermal stability,good catalytic properties and rich reactivity,therefore attracting much attention from researchers in recent years.Starting from the[Cp*IrCl2]2(Cp*=pentamethylcyclopentadienyl)structure,a series of iridium(Ⅲ)complexes containing half-sandwich structures are synthesized.On top of that,the application of these complexes in N-alkylation of amine compounds is studied.The main research work is as follows:1.A series of acylhydrazone ligands are prepared by reacting benzoylhydrazine with acetophenone of different electronic substituent effect.Later,by reacting the acylhydrazone ligands with[Cp*IrCl2]2,the half-sandwich iridium complexes that support N,O-coordination with acylhydrazone ligands are successfully prepared.Then,the synthesized iridium complexes are characterized by NMR,EA,FI-IR,etc.The single crystals of the complexes are also cultured by means of solvent diffusion to confirm their fine structures by X-ray diffraction.Moreover,with the complexes as catalysts,the optimal conditions for the N-alkylation reaction of alcohols and amines are topped out.According to the results,the iridium complexes have high catalytic efficiency and good substrate universality.2.By reacting benzoylhydrazine with acetophenone with different electronic substituent effect under acidic conditions and then reacting the four synthesized ligands with different electronic effect with[(p-cymene)RuCl2]2,a series of N,O-coordinated half-sandwich ruthenium complexes are produced.The obtained complexes are characterized by NMR,FI-IR,etc.
